HOPEWELL VALLEY: HVCBank has announced record earnings for 2014
Hopewell Valley Community Bank (PinkSheets: HWDY) has announced that net income for 2014 established a new bank record, ending the year at $2,523,528 or $.67 per share. HAMILTON: Help the bluebirds with a house
Due to habitat destruction and fierce competition from more aggressive bird species, the United States almost lost its bluebird population. However, after decades of conservation efforts, the species has been making a comeback. BORDENTOWN TOWNSHIP: Arrests made in alleged prescription fraud
Two Chicago men were arrested after allegedly passing fraudulent prescriptions in 21 local pharmacies to obtain pints of promethazine with codeine syrup, which abusers typically mix with a soft drink and consume to get high.
